Follow-up to #30257, which merged with describe.skip on most of the oauth/usage/inference CLI tests to unblock CI after the CLI→IPC migration cascade (#30238#30251).

This PR closes out the debt.

Add — daemon route coverage

assistant/src/__tests__/oauth-commands-routes.test.ts (new, 711 lines, 36 tests).

Exercises all 9 IPC endpoints introduced in #30251: oauth_disconnect, oauth_mode_get, oauth_mode_set, oauth_status, oauth_ping, oauth_token, oauth_request, oauth_managed_connect_start, oauth_managed_connect_poll.

Coverage per endpoint: route-registry sanity, missing-arg validation, unknown-provider rejection, managed-vs-BYO dispatch, and the most-trafficked happy / error paths. This handler-level gap predates #30257 but needed to close before the CLI dupes could be deleted.

Delete — pre-IPC dead tests

Every top-level describe in these files was describe.skip'd against in-process code paths that no longer exist after the IPC migration:

  • 9 × assistant/src/cli/commands/oauth/__tests__/*.test.ts (connect, disconnect, mode, ping, status, token, providers-register, providers-update, providers-delete)
  • assistant/src/__tests__/credentials-cli.test.ts (1232 lines)
  • assistant/src/cli/commands/__tests__/routes.test.ts (576 lines)

Trim — keep only living CLI plumbing

File Before After What survives
oauth-cli.test.ts 2103 135 requirePlatformConnection helper (3 tests)
usage-cli.test.ts 153 85 Invalid --group-by validation
inference-send.test.ts 643 236 Help text × 4, no-message guard × 2, --max-tokens validation

Each trimmed file gained a top-of-file docstring explaining what was removed and why, plus follow-up bullets for IPC-mocked CLI plumbing tests if anyone wants to recover deeper coverage at the CLI layer.

Coverage check

The business logic that the deleted CLI tests nominally covered already runs through:

  • oauth-store.test.ts (provider/connection persistence)
  • credential-vault.test.ts (token-manager / withValidToken)
  • oauth-apps-routes.test.ts, oauth-providers-routes.test.ts, oauth-connect-routes.test.ts (the other 3 oauth route surfaces)
  • usage-routes.test.ts (usage aggregation)
  • New oauth-commands-routes.test.ts (the 9 command endpoints)

No coverage regression in moved logic. The only new coverage is the daemon-side route layer this PR adds.

Diff stat

15 files changed, 797 insertions(+), 9910 deletions(-)

Follow-ups (not blocking)

Called out in each trimmed file's docstring:

  • CLI plumbing tests for exitFromIpcResult exit-code mapping, shouldOutputJson / writeOutput output formatting, and the oauth token shell-lockdown guard (VELLUM_UNTRUSTED_SHELL=1)
  • IPC-mock-based tests for the trimmed inference-send / usage paths if anyone wants stronger end-to-end coverage
